Prof. Kirk McKenzie

Professor Kirk McKenzie (ANU, CI in 2021) joined EQUS after 11 years at the Jet Propulsion Laboratory at the California Institute of Technology. CI McKenzie brings to EQUS his research on space-based optical systems, focusing on laser stabilization for gravity-sensing. The ANU has collaborated with CI Stace on applications of laser ranging.  McKenzie won the NASA Exceptional Public Achievement Medal (2019), the NASA Group Achievement Award (2019), and the NASA/JPL Voyager Award (2018).
